Live webinars and masterclasses

Oracle Live is our WebEx programme presented by our technical managers, business development managers and PruConsulting team. You can sign up for our monthly sessions on our PruAdviser website, where you’ll also be able to watch recordings of past ones, including topics like financial planning, industry updates and technical expertise.

We’ve also introduced new WebEx masterclasses, which offer you an advanced level of technical information and learning opportunities. Topics covered in these include trustee investment and pension planning.

So far this year, 7,800 people have attended our seven Oracle Live WebEx sessions and we’ve had more than 1,700 attendees dialling in to our five Oracle Live masterclasses, providing you with more than 15 hours of structured CPD to choose from.

Regular Oracle publications

Our Oracle publications are packed with technical expertise, information on topical industry matters, and commentary on legislative and regulatory developments.

Oracle, our quarterly magazine, includes articles by our technical experts, business development managers, PruConsulting and other internal industry experts, as well as relevant external independent commentary, all aimed at giving you planning angles to use with your clients. This year so far, we’ve published 37 articles with useful and relevant information that all qualify as structured CPD.

Oracle Technical is our highly popular monthly online digest of legislative and regulatory developments in the industry.

NEW CPD accredited video content

Knowledge TV is Prudential’s new on-demand library of videos containing industry updates, technical expertise and insight, and information about our funds, tools and services.

A new development for us this year is structured CPD accredited video content. We’ve already created a taxation of bonds boxset and coming soon are boxsets on taxation of trusts, OEICs and pension death benefits.

Test and evidence your learning

Through our Test Centre, we offer an easy way for you to keep a record of your CPD, and to evidence your completed activities and the targeted learning outcomes, as required by the regulator. On completion of your test, you’ll gain a certificate for your structured CPD.
